What Does a Room Addition Project Include?
A room addition includes site preparation, foundation work, framing, roofing, exterior finish, insulation, electrical and HVAC integration, interior finish, and final inspection to match existing construction.
The process begins with measuring the site and verifying setbacks and local building requirements. A new foundation is poured to support the addition, and framing is erected using lumber and techniques that match the original home's structure. Roof lines are tied into the existing roofline, and exterior siding is matched as closely as possible.
Interior work includes running electrical circuits, extending HVAC ductwork or adding a separate mini split, and installing insulation to meet or exceed current energy codes. Drywall, flooring, trim, and paint complete the interior, and the addition is inspected to ensure it meets all applicable standards. The result is a new room or suite that feels like part of the original home rather than an obvious add-on.
How Do You Tie HVAC Systems Into a New Addition?
HVAC integration involves extending existing ductwork with properly sized supply and return runs or installing a dedicated mini split system if the current system lacks capacity to serve the added space.
Before framing is closed in, the HVAC contractor evaluates whether the existing furnace and air conditioner can handle the additional square footage. If capacity is adequate, new ducts are run through the floor joists or attic and connected to the main trunk lines. Registers are placed to deliver balanced airflow, and dampers may be added to control zone temperatures.
If the existing system is already at capacity or if running ducts is impractical, a ductless mini split is installed to serve the new addition independently. This approach is common in Dimit's older homes where the original HVAC system was sized for a smaller footprint. The mini split provides efficient heating and cooling without overloading the main system or requiring extensive duct modifications.

How Do Dimit's Building Conditions and Climate Affect Addition Planning?
Soil stability, wind exposure, and temperature extremes require solid foundation footings, secure roof tie-ins, and insulation upgrades to ensure new additions perform well and match the durability of existing structures.
Dimit's clay soils can shift with moisture changes, so footings for additions must be poured deep enough to reach stable ground and prevent settling or cracking. Roof connections are critical in high-wind areas; proper flashing and structural fasteners prevent leaks and uplift during storms that are common across the Texas Panhandle.
Insulation and air sealing in the addition must meet or exceed current codes to avoid creating hot or cold spots that strain the HVAC system. Matching exterior materials and finishes ensures the addition weathers at the same rate as the original home, maintaining both appearance and structural integrity. Careful planning during the design phase accounts for these local factors and delivers a room addition that lasts for decades.
